France`s import shipments of extruded polypropylene foam in 2024 saw a shift in concentration levels, moving from low to moderate concentration according to the Herfindahl-Hirschman Index (HHI). Top exporting countries to France included Spain, Belgium, Germany, Italy, and the UK. Despite a negative compound annual growth rate (CAGR) of -2.56% from 2020 to 2024, the growth rate from 2023 to 2024 experienced a significant decline of -24.75%. This data suggests a challenging market environment for extruded polypropylene foam imports into France, with fluctuations in concentration levels and declining growth rates.

The France extruded polypropylene foam market is experiencing steady growth driven by various industries such as packaging, automotive, construction, and electronics. The lightweight nature, excellent thermal insulation properties, and moisture resistance of extruded polypropylene foam make it a popular choice for manufacturers. The packaging industry is a significant contributor to the market demand, particularly for protective packaging solutions. In the automotive sector, the foam is used for interior components, door panels, and under-body shields due to its durability and energy absorption capabilities. The construction industry also utilizes extruded polypropylene foam for insulation purposes. The market is characterized by key players offering a wide range of product applications and customization options to cater to diverse industry requirements. Ongoing research and development activities focused on enhancing the material properties are expected to further drive market growth in France.

In the France extruded polypropylene foam market, some key challenges include increasing competition from alternative materials such as polyethylene foam and polystyrene foam, which offer similar properties at potentially lower costs. Additionally, fluctuations in raw material prices, particularly polypropylene resin, can impact the overall production costs for manufacturers. The market also faces challenges related to environmental concerns and regulations, as polypropylene foam is not easily recyclable and may face scrutiny for its sustainability credentials. Furthermore, the COVID-19 pandemic has disrupted supply chains and impacted demand in various industries, which has a direct effect on the extruded polypropylene foam market in France. Overall, companies in this market need to focus on innovation, cost efficiency, and sustainability to overcome these challenges and stay competitive.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
